What Are Rolex Golfers?

Rolex golfers are professional and amateur golfers who wear Rolex watches while playing golf. These golfers are chosen by Rolex to represent their brand and have become ambassadors of sorts for the Rolex brand.

Many of these Rolex golfers are household names, such as Phil Mickelson, Tiger Woods, and Rory McIlroy. These golfers represent the Rolex brand on and off the golf course and have helped to increase Rolex’s popularity in the world of golf.
